Detailed explanation-1: -ostrich, (Struthio camelus), large flightless bird found only in open country in Africa. The largest living bird, an adult male may be 2.75 metres (about 9 feet) tall-almost half of its height is neck-and weigh more than 150 kg (330 pounds); the female is somewhat smaller.
